网盘下载新革命:如何用开源脚本让九大网盘文件下载速度提升5倍?

网盘下载新革命:如何用开源脚本让九大网盘文件下载速度提升5倍?

网盘下载新革命:如何用开源脚本让九大网盘文件下载速度提升5倍?

【免费下载链接】Online-disk-direct-link-download-assistant一个基于 JavaScript 的网盘文件下载地址获取工具。基于【网盘直链下载助手】修改 ,支持 百度网盘 / 阿里云盘 / 中国移动云盘 / 天翼云盘 / 迅雷云盘 / 夸克网盘 / UC网盘 / 123云盘 八大网盘项目地址: https://gitcode.com/GitHub_Trending/on/Online-disk-direct-link-download-assistant

还在为网盘下载速度慢、必须安装官方客户端而烦恼吗?今天我要分享一个让我彻底告别下载困境的神器——一个基于JavaScript的开源脚本,它能智能解析九大主流网盘的真实下载地址,让你在浏览器中直接获取文件直链,彻底摆脱客户端的束缚!

第一章:打破传统下载的枷锁

想象一下这个场景:你需要从百度网盘下载一个3GB的科研资料包,打开官方客户端,看着几十KB/s的下载速度,心里默默计算着需要等待的时间——这几乎是每个网盘用户的日常。但今天,我要告诉你一个完全不同的故事。

这个开源脚本就像一个数字钥匙匠,它能够巧妙地打开网盘官方API的大门,为你生成真实的文件下载链接。最神奇的是,这一切都在你的浏览器中完成,无需安装任何额外的软件,也不需要将你的文件上传到任何第三方服务器。

第二章:你的私人下载管家

安装这个脚本就像给你的浏览器增加了一个智能助手。它会在你访问百度网盘、阿里云盘、中国移动云盘、天翼云盘、迅雷云盘、夸克网盘、UC网盘、123云盘等九大网盘时,自动在文件列表下方添加一个"解析直链"按钮。

点击这个按钮,你会看到一个简洁的下载选项菜单:

  • API下载:适合IDM、浏览器自带下载器
  • Aria下载:专为XDown、Linux命令行设计
  • RPC下载:完美适配Motrix、Aria2 Tools
  • cURL下载:Windows/Linux/Mac终端用户的福音
  • BC下载:比特彗星用户的最爱
  • 增强下载:多块多线程下载,速度翻倍

第三章:技术背后的智慧

这个脚本的工作原理就像一位数字翻译官,它能够理解不同网盘的语言规则。每个网盘都有自己独特的API接口和验证机制,脚本通过精心设计的配置文件来适配这些差异。

让我带你看看背后的秘密。在项目的config/目录中,你会找到六个关键的配置文件:

  1. config.json- 百度网盘的通行证
  2. ali.json- 阿里云盘的钥匙串
  3. tianyi.json- 天翼云盘的密码本
  4. xunlei.json- 迅雷云盘的解码器
  5. quark.json- 夸克网盘的加密器
  6. yidong.json- 移动云盘的多节点路由表

以百度网盘为例,config/config.json文件中包含了四个核心API接口:

{ "pcs": { "0": "https://pan.baidu.com/rest/2.0/xpan/multimedia?method=filemetas&dlink=1", "1": "https://pan.baidu.com/api/sharedownload?channel=chunlei&clienttype=12&web=1&app_id=250528", "2": "https://pan.baidu.com/share/tplconfig?fields=sign,timestamp&channel=chunlei&web=1&app_id=250528&clienttype=0", "3": "https://openapi.baidu.com/oauth/2.0/authorize?client_id=IlLqBbU3GjQ0t46TRwFateTprHWl39zF&response_type=token&redirect_uri=oob&confirm_login=0&scope=basic,netdisk" } }

这些接口就像四个不同的门,脚本会根据不同的场景选择最合适的入口,确保你能够顺利获取到文件的真实下载地址。

第四章:实战演练室

让我分享三个真实的使用场景,看看这个脚本如何改变你的下载体验:

场景一:学术研究者的福音

作为一名研究生,我经常需要下载大量的学术论文和数据集。以前,我需要一个个点击下载按钮,等待每个文件缓慢下载。现在,我只需要:

  1. 全选所有需要的文件
  2. 点击"解析直链"按钮
  3. 选择"Aria下载"模式
  4. 将生成的命令粘贴到终端

原本需要3-4小时的下载任务,现在45分钟就能完成,效率提升了4倍!

场景二:团队协作的新方式

上周,我需要将5GB的设计文件分享给团队成员。传统方式是上传到网盘,然后让每个人单独下载。现在,我的做法是:

  1. 解析文件直链,生成24小时有效的下载链接
  2. 通过团队聊天工具分发链接
  3. 每个人使用自己习惯的下载工具获取文件

这不仅节省了我的上传时间,还避免了团队成员重复下载的麻烦。

场景三:自动化备份的得力助手

作为一名开发者,我使用这个脚本配合crontab实现了自动备份:

#!/bin/bash # 每周日凌晨2点自动备份网盘重要文件 0 2 * * 0 curl -L -o "/backup/weekly_$(date +%Y%m%d).zip" "解析后的直链地址"

第五章:安全与隐私的守护者

你可能担心:这个脚本安全吗?会不会泄露我的隐私?

让我告诉你三个关键事实:

  1. 本地处理原则:所有解析操作都在你的浏览器中完成,就像在你的电脑上安装了一个本地计算器,数据不会离开你的设备。

  2. 透明开源:所有代码都在GitHub上公开,任何人都可以审查。这就像把菜谱完全公开,你可以看到每一道工序。

  3. 合法合规:脚本使用的是网盘官方公开的API接口,就像使用官方提供的工具一样合法。

第六章:常见问题解答室

Q:为什么我安装了脚本却看不到"解析直链"按钮?

A:这就像给手机安装了新应用但忘记打开权限一样。请检查:

  • 浏览器扩展管理器是否已启用脚本
  • 是否访问了支持的网盘页面
  • 浏览器控制台是否有错误信息

Q:下载速度为什么没有明显提升?

A:想象一下高速公路和乡间小路的区别。脚本提供了高速公路的入口,但车速还取决于:

  • 你的网络环境质量
  • 是否使用了专业下载工具(如IDM、Aria2)
  • 网盘服务商当时的服务器负载

Q:批量下载时部分文件失败怎么办?

A:这就像同时搬运多个箱子,偶尔会掉一个。建议:

  • 减少并发下载数量
  • 检查网络连接稳定性
  • 确保所有文件都已成功勾选

第七章:高级技巧工作坊

技巧一:下载器参数优化

如果你使用Aria2,试试这个优化配置:

aria2c -c -s 16 -x 16 -k 10M \ --max-concurrent-downloads=5 \ --max-connection-per-server=16 \ --min-split-size=10M \ --split=16 \ --file-allocation=none \ "你的下载链接"

技巧二:跨平台配置指南

  • Windows用户:搭配IDM使用,设置最大连接数为16
  • macOS用户:使用Motrix,启用RPC服务(端口6800)
  • Linux用户:Aria2命令行模式,配合screen或tmux保持后台运行
  • Android用户:ADM Pro是多线程下载的最佳选择

技巧三:网络环境优化

  1. 更换DNS服务器为114.114.114.114或8.8.8.8
  2. 避开网络高峰时段(工作日晚间)
  3. 定期清理浏览器缓存和下载历史

第八章:未来展望与社区共建

这个项目最让我感动的是它的开源精神。就像一棵树,它从一个小小的脚本成长为支持九大网盘的强大工具,全靠社区的浇灌。

目前项目已经有:

  • 持续更新的维护团队
  • 活跃的用户反馈社区
  • 完善的错误修复机制

如果你在使用过程中遇到问题,可以:

  1. 在GitHub上提交issue
  2. 查看项目的更新日志
  3. 参与社区讨论

第九章:我的个人使用心得

使用这个脚本半年多,我有几个深刻的体会:

  1. 稳定性超乎想象:最初我担心频繁更新会导致不稳定,但实际上每个版本都更加完善。

  2. 社区支持很给力:遇到问题时,在GitHub上提问通常几小时内就能得到回复。

  3. 学习成本极低:即使你不是技术人员,按照README的步骤操作,10分钟就能上手。

  4. 真正的自由下载:不再被某个下载器绑定,可以根据需要选择最适合的工具。

第十章:开始你的下载革命

现在,是时候开始你的下载革命了。整个过程只需要三个步骤:

第一步:准备工具

git clone https://gitcode.com/GitHub_Trending/on/Online-disk-direct-link-download-assistant

第二步:安装脚本

  1. 在浏览器中安装Tampermonkey扩展
  2. 打开扩展管理面板
  3. 选择"从文件安装"
  4. 选择刚才下载的(改)网盘直链下载助手.user.js文件

第三步:开始使用访问任意支持的网盘,你会看到文件列表下方出现了新的下载选项。

最后的思考

这个开源脚本不仅仅是一个工具,它代表了一种下载理念的转变。从"被动接受网盘限制"到"主动掌控下载过程",这种转变带来的不仅是速度的提升,更是使用体验的根本改变。

记住,技术应该服务于人,而不是束缚人。这个脚本正是这一理念的完美体现——它用开源的力量,让每个人都能享受到更好的下载体验。

重要提醒:请合理使用本工具,尊重网盘服务商的服务条款。遇到问题时,及时在GitHub上反馈,让我们共同完善这个优秀的开源项目。下载的自由,从现在开始!

【免费下载链接】Online-disk-direct-link-download-assistant一个基于 JavaScript 的网盘文件下载地址获取工具。基于【网盘直链下载助手】修改 ,支持 百度网盘 / 阿里云盘 / 中国移动云盘 / 天翼云盘 / 迅雷云盘 / 夸克网盘 / UC网盘 / 123云盘 八大网盘项目地址: https://gitcode.com/GitHub_Trending/on/Online-disk-direct-link-download-assistant

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考